Artist Bio:
Richard Marx is an American singer, songwriter, and musician who rose to fame in the late 1980s and 1990s. He was born on September 16, 1963, in Chicago, Illinois. Marx has released a number of successful albums throughout his career, including his self-titled debut album in 1987 which spawned four top 5 singles on the Billboard Hot 100 chart. He is known for his soft rock and adult contemporary sound, with hits such as "Right Here Waiting," "Hold On to the Nights," and "Now and Forever."


In addition to his solo music career, Marx has also written and produced songs for other artists, including Luther Vandross, NSYNC, and Keith Urban. He has won several awards for his songwriting, including a Grammy Award for Song of the Year in 2004 for co-writing Luther Vandross' "Dance with My Father." Marx continues to tour and release new music, showcasing his enduring popularity in the music industry.
